For most snakes, I try to relocate them, either by shooing them away or capturing them.  I actually prefer to handle larger snakes, as I can get a better grip.  The garter snake was about two feet long and coiled, so I got behind it, distracted its gaze with one hand and immobilized the head with the other long enough for me to pick it up.

Grabbing the snake directly behind the head is the most effective way of handling to avoid being bitten.
